Funny story from a character actor about working with Steven Seagal
He showed up to film the first scene of The Glimmer Man, where he was to play a serial killer that Seagal kills. But the director takes him aside and tells him Steven Seagal is having a spiritual crisis and has decided he won't kill people in movies any more. The director charges him with convincing Seagal to kill him.
